This Victorian-inspired collection uses gentle rhyming poetry to introduce children to the residents of a bustling farmyard, from fluffy chicks to sturdy horses. Through the charm of delicate pop-up illustrations, the book fosters a sense of nostalgia and appreciation for the natural world. It is ideally suited for children aged 3 to 7, offering a sensory experience that builds vocabulary and encourages a love for animals. Parents will appreciate the classic aesthetic and the way it transforms a simple reading session into an interactive discovery of life's small, rhythmic joys.
